环境中全氟有机物的毒性、检测分析及降解 被引量:15

The toxicity,monitoring analysis and decomposition of perfluoroganics in the environment

摘要 自全氟有机物广泛使用50多年以来,已经在世界范围内发现一定浓度的全氟有机物,各国研究人员针对该类物质特别是全氟辛酸(PFOA)、全氟辛烷基磺酸(PFOS)进行了一定的研究。介绍了该类物质的污染现状,阐述了全氟有机物的毒性、检测分析技术及降解技术,在此基础上提出了今后的研究方向。 Perfluoroganics were widely used for more than fifty years, now they were found in global environment,and these compounds,especially perfluoroctanoic acid(PFOA) and perfluorooctane sulfonate(PFOS) were researched by many investigators. These perfluoroganics were reviewd in terms of pollution status, toxicity, analytical technologies and decomposition methods. Further, some comment on its future research were presented.
